Skip to content

Commit 9fc28fd

Browse files
committed
SDK-2532: Rename IdentityProfileSubjectPayload -> SubjectPayload
1 parent b3c0959 commit 9fc28fd

File tree

3 files changed

+12
-13
lines changed

3 files changed

+12
-13
lines changed

yoti-sdk-api/src/main/java/com/yoti/api/client/docs/session/create/SessionSpec.java

Lines changed: 5 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,6 @@
33
import java.time.ZonedDateTime;
44
import java.util.ArrayList;
55
import java.util.List;
6-
import java.util.Map;
76

87
import com.yoti.api.client.docs.session.create.check.RequestedCheck;
98
import com.yoti.api.client.docs.session.create.filters.RequiredDocument;
@@ -62,7 +61,7 @@ public class SessionSpec {
6261
private final AdvancedIdentityProfileRequirementsPayload advancedIdentityProfileRequirements;
6362

6463
@JsonProperty(Property.SUBJECT)
65-
private final IdentityProfileSubjectPayload subject;
64+
private final SubjectPayload subject;
6665

6766
@JsonProperty(Property.RESOURCES)
6867
private final ResourceCreationContainer resources;
@@ -83,7 +82,7 @@ public class SessionSpec {
8382
IbvOptions ibvOptions,
8483
ZonedDateTime sessionDeadline,
8584
IdentityProfileRequirementsPayload identityProfile,
86-
IdentityProfileSubjectPayload subject,
85+
SubjectPayload subject,
8786
ResourceCreationContainer resources,
8887
Boolean createIdentityProfilePreview,
8988
AdvancedIdentityProfileRequirementsPayload advancedIdentityProfileRequirements) {
@@ -233,7 +232,7 @@ public IdentityProfileRequirementsPayload getIdentityProfile() {
233232
*
234233
* @return subject
235234
*/
236-
public IdentityProfileSubjectPayload getSubject() {
235+
public SubjectPayload getSubject() {
237236
return subject;
238237
}
239238

@@ -280,7 +279,7 @@ public static class Builder {
280279
private ZonedDateTime sessionDeadline;
281280
private IdentityProfileRequirementsPayload identityProfile;
282281
private AdvancedIdentityProfileRequirementsPayload advancedIdentityProfileRequirementsPayload;
283-
private IdentityProfileSubjectPayload subject;
282+
private SubjectPayload subject;
284283
private ResourceCreationContainer resources;
285284
private Boolean createIdentityProfilePreview;
286285

@@ -440,7 +439,7 @@ public Builder withIdentityProfile(IdentityProfileRequirementsPayload identityPr
440439
* @param subject the subject
441440
* @return the Builder
442441
*/
443-
public Builder withSubject(IdentityProfileSubjectPayload subject) {
442+
public Builder withSubject(SubjectPayload subject) {
444443
this.subject = subject;
445444
return this;
446445
}
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-2,12 +2,12 @@
22

33
import com.fasterxml.jackson.annotation.JsonProperty;
44

5-
public class IdentityProfileSubjectPayload {
5+
public class SubjectPayload {
66

77
@JsonProperty("subject_id")
88
private final String subjectId;
99

10-
IdentityProfileSubjectPayload(String subjectId) {
10+
SubjectPayload(String subjectId) {
1111
this.subjectId = subjectId;
1212
}
1313

@@ -36,8 +36,8 @@ public Builder withSubjectId(String subjectId) {
3636
return this;
3737
}
3838

39-
public IdentityProfileSubjectPayload build() {
40-
return new IdentityProfileSubjectPayload(subjectId);
39+
public SubjectPayload build() {
40+
return new SubjectPayload(subjectId);
4141
}
4242

4343
}

yoti-sdk-api/src/test/java/com/yoti/api/client/docs/session/create/SessionSpecTest.java

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-48,7 +48,7 @@ public class SessionSpecTest {
4848
@Mock ResourceCreationContainer resourceCreationContainerMock;
4949
@Mock ImportTokenPayload importTokenMock;
5050
@Mock IdentityProfileRequirementsPayload identityProfileRequirementsPayloadMock;
51-
@Mock IdentityProfileSubjectPayload identityProfileSubjectPayloadMock;
51+
@Mock SubjectPayload subjectPayloadMock;
5252

5353
@Test
5454
public void shouldBuildWithMinimalConfiguration() {
@@ -218,10 +218,10 @@ public void withIdentityProfile_shouldSetTheIdentityProfile() {
218218
@Test
219219
public void withSubject_shouldSetTheSubject() {
220220
SessionSpec result = SessionSpec.builder()
221-
.withSubject(identityProfileSubjectPayloadMock)
221+
.withSubject(subjectPayloadMock)
222222
.build();
223223

224-
assertThat(result.getSubject(), is(identityProfileSubjectPayloadMock));
224+
assertThat(result.getSubject(), is(subjectPayloadMock));
225225
}
226226

227227
@Test

0 commit comments

Comments
 (0)